commit 5fbbf6620fedd54a96267c0b6da7349e62c8473b
Author: Bastian Blank <waldi@debian.org>
Date:   Sat Apr 4 20:54:26 2009 +0000

    parisc: Remove casts from atomic macros
    
    The atomic operations on parisc are defined as macros. The macros
    includes casts which disallows the use of some syntax elements and
    produces error like this:
    
    net/phonet/pep.c: In function 'pipe_rcv_status':
    net/phonet/pep.c:262: error: lvalue required as left operand of assignment
    
    The patch removes this superfluous casts.
